National Guard units can also be mobilized for federal active duty to supplement regular armed forces during times of war or national emergency declared by Congress, the President or the Secretary of Defense.Approximately five months in initial active duty for basic training and Advanced Individual Training.A 10 week basic training sprint to become physically and mentally stronger.When not on active duty, reserve soldiers typically perform training/service one weekend per month, currently referred to as Battle Assembly, and for two continuous weeks at some time during the year referred to as Annual Training (AT).When not on active duty, reserve soldiers typically perform training/service one weekend a month and for two continuous weeks at summer training periodsEight-year service contract; all eight years in Reserve Component (RC); or two, three, or four years in Active Component with the rest in RC.Six-year service contract per enlistment period; with 6 months or two years spent in active duty, of which no more than one year will be spent overseas.All U.S. Army Reserve soldiers are subject to mobilization throughout the term of their enlistment.All National Guard are subject to mobilization throughout the term of their enlistment. Together, the Army Reserve and the Army National Guard make up the Reserve components of the United States Armed Forces.The National Guard has a total of 54 separate organizations; one for each of the 50 states and the one for the territories of Guam, Virgin Islands, Puerto Rico, and the District of Columbia. However, a person, who is in the Reserve, is in the army only part time, and their services are called on as and when required.If a person sign up for the Army Reserve, they will be trained the same as an active army soldier.
